1 Products availableA Thermowell is a protective enclosure for Temperature Gauges and Temperature Sensors ( Inserts), which enhance the life of the Inserts from the corrosive and abrasive( harsh) service conditions at the installation point without affecting the performance of the Temperature Sensors or Gauges. A Thermowell allows the temperature sensor to be removed and replaced without compromising either the ambient region or the process.

Three Major Types of Thermowells.Using BarBar Stock Thermowells are offered for Insertion Lengths up to 600mm as a Standard.
Insertion Lengths can also be provided up to 900mm in Bar Stock if required.
Fabricated Thermowells are generally preferred for Insertion Lengths above 600mm.
We have a IN HOUSE Wake Frequency Calculator , in accordance with ASME PTC 19.3 TW-2010 for determining the Insertion Length and the Type of Construction best suited for the Process Parameters as required by the Client.

A thermocouple is a device that is used for measuring temperature. It basically consists of two dissimilar metals , that are joined to form a junction, which when heated , produce a thermoelectric voltage. This voltage changes as the temperature increases or decreases. Thermocouples are self powered and require no external form of excitation. Thermocouples are widely used in science and industry applications include, temperature measurement for kilns, gas turbine exhaust, diesel engines, and other industrial processes

Such Type of thermocouples are ideal for the reliable measurement of tube wall temperatures in fired heaters which is important for prolonging tube life and ensuring safe and efficient operation.
The Tube temperature Thermocouple is designed to be responsive to tube wall temperature by placing the thermo-junction in fused contact with the tube wall thus providing a direct and total metallic heat transfer path from the sheath to the Tube wall. Such type of thermocouples provides better accuracy, superior reliability, improved longevity and ease of installation . Tube or Skin type thermocouples can be designed and factory formed to suit nearly any installation or application based on the clients requirement.

Thermocouples are generally used with an outer protecting tube or pocket / thermowell to protect it from corrosive process conditions. This improves the life of the thermocouple. However, response time is compromised.
To overcome above problem, MI Thickwall Thermocouple are designed having thicker wall with relatively larger conductor diameters. This construction enables the user to insert the thermocouple directly in the process medium without a protecting tube or pocket/ thermowell, thus improving the response time to a great extent in some process conditions.
Thickwall thermocouple offers high performance and longer life in harsh process environments, providing improved resistance to temperature, vibration, impact, corrosion and abrasion.
These type of thermocouples, are very well suited to harsh, high temperature process environments such as incinerators, heat treatment furnaces and industrial ovens, and hence can be used effectively for measuring the temperature of molten metal also.
In such type, the gap between the element and the thick wall sheath is densely filled with high purity magnesium oxide (MgO), which prevents any residual air from penetrating the sheath and enables the product to withstand severe conditions, providing excellent corrosion and heat resistance.
This enables faster response times compared to conventional standard thermocouple assembly. The thermocouple element is protected by the thick wall sheath and high purity magnesium oxide, which can be supplied in large diameters with a very thick wall sheath providing a high resistance to vibration and impact shocks

A Indicating Pressure Switch is a form of switch that closes an electrical contact when a certain set pressure has been reached on its input. It offers a dual advantage of Indication and Switching. The switch may be designed to make contact either on pressure rise or on pressure fall. Because of their robust design, they are suitable for harsh environment and most corrosive media and meet stringent demands to bring the advantages of high accuracy, long term stability and protection against water jets and dust on their moving parts.

High Temperature Thermocouples are especially designed for the temperature range from 600 C upto 1600 C. Noble metal thermocouples (also called rare metal thermocouples) are used to make the thermocouples. The most common types are R, S & B rare metal thermocouple assemblies. Major Applications include, Glass Industry, Steel Plants, electric arc furnace etc.

A Resistance Temperature Detector (RTD) senses heat, based on the principle, that a change in temperature, results in a corresponding change in the resistance of a wire. A small excitation current is passed along the element, the resultant voltage is measured and converted to units of temperature.
RTDs have achieved a well deserved reputation in various Industries for their superior stability and accuracy. The result makes these devices well suited for a wide variety of applications.
